Basement Excavation in Salt Lake City, UT
Basement excavation services involve the careful removal of soil and other materials to prepare a space beneath a property for various construction projects. This process is often used to create additional living areas, storage spaces, or to support foundation repairs and upgrades. Property owners typically request basement excavation when planning to finish or remodel their basement, install new foundations, or address issues like water intrusion or structural instability. Understanding the scope of excavation work, including site preparation, proper drainage, and soil stability, is essential before requesting services to ensure the project meets safety and structural standards.
Before requesting basement excavation, property owners should consider factors such as the existing foundation type, local soil conditions, and any permits or regulations that may apply. It’s also important to evaluate the intended use of the space and communicate specific needs, such as waterproofing or insulation. Proper planning can help prevent potential issues during excavation, such as water management problems or damage to existing structures. Consulting with experienced professionals can provide guidance on project feasibility, necessary preparations, and the best approach to achieve the desired results effectively and safely.

Common Basement Excavation Jobs
Basement foundation excavation - prepares the area for new or improved basement structures.
Basement waterproofing excavation - removes soil to access and repair drainage systems and prevent water intrusion.
Basement remodel excavation - creates space for finishing or expanding existing basement areas.
Drainage system excavation - installs or upgrades underground drainage to protect the basement from flooding.
Utility trench excavation - provides access for plumbing, electrical, or HVAC system installations in the basement.
Crawl space excavation - prepares the area below the home for proper ventilation and moisture control.
Basement Excavation Questions
What types of projects require basement excavation? Basement excavation is often needed for foundation repairs, basement finishing, or installing new drainage systems.
Is basement excavation suitable for all property types? It is typically suitable for properties with accessible yards and stable soil conditions, but site assessments are recommended.
What should property owners consider before starting basement excavation? It's important to evaluate the property's foundation, soil stability, and local regulations before beginning excavation work.
How does basement excavation impact property drainage? Proper excavation can improve drainage around the foundation, helping to prevent water issues and basement flooding.
